The Role of Vapendavir


Vapendavir is an oral rhinovirus capsid inhibitor, which means it works by targeting and disrupting the virus's ability to replicate. Rhinovirus is notorious for causing approximately 50% of acute exacerbations in COPD patients. The upcoming abstract titled "Inflammatory Biomarkers Are Reduced by Vapendavir Treatment in Rhinovirus-Challenged COPD Patients" will be presented by Dr. Sebastian Johnston, a leading respiratory researcher from VirTus Respiratory Research in London.

This oral presentation aims to summarize findings from a double-blind, placebo-controlled study that evaluated the effects of vapendavir on immune responses in COPD patients who were challenged with rhinovirus. Details surrounding additional findings will remain under embargo until the presentation on September 9, which will focus on respiratory infections and the host's response, complications, and interventions.

Implications for COPD


Acute exacerbations of COPD are a significant concern, having serious impacts on patient morbidity and mortality. These exacerbations are closely linked to accelerated lung function decline and a significantly reduced quality of life. With rhinovirus being a primary culprit, the ability of vapendavir to reduce inflammation could shift the treatment paradigm for COPD patients.

Ongoing Clinical Trials


In addition to this pivotal presentation, Altesa BioSciences is actively progressing with its clinical trials. The Phase 2b CARDINAL trial has recently enrolled its first patient. The objective of this trial is to further investigate how vapendavir may alleviate both upper and lower airway symptoms, reduce the illness duration, and improve lung function in the small airways when compared with a placebo.
